About the 2nd law of thermodynamics...
It says that the entropy in a closed system always increases. The Earth and the Sun are in the same system. The nuclear fusion that occurs in the Sun increases the entropy of the system. The decrease in entropy that happens in Earth is SMALLER than the increase in the Sun, so the result variation in entropy is positive. So there's no conflict with the 2nd law of thermodynamics.
